Re: Few fillets from this mornin

Bowl
I go out early to avoid others on Water and Ramp
I follow the tides and clouds
No Pinkies or Sealice at the moment
I havent had to measure a Fish for months-They are all good size Fat Ones
Get most fish at about 1/2 hour before first light then they go off bite about 1 1/2 hours later

Re: Few fillets from this mornin

Blue After Fish caught I put them in a scaling bag to clean all slime and scales off Take a fillet off both sides and leave skin on Use a fork to hold fillet rib cage up then slice all bones off Doesnt matter if I waste a bit of meat on each one as this feeds the local Pelicans https://i.imgur.com/i...
